Uncharted DLC And Updates Takes A Break Until Next Year

Naughty Dog has stated on their Facebook that the Uncharted devs (now that The Last Of Us is in production it appears that there’s a current legitimate distinction between Naughty Dog and Uncharted developers) will not be releasing any post-launch support for Uncharted 3 until 2012.

There haven’t been any glaring issues with release like the ones seen with Battlefield 3 or Skyrim, but post-launch content is always nice. But no upcoming content will see the year 2011.

Included in the upcoming DLC is the Flashback Map Pack #1 which is apparently just a few maps from Uncharted 2. But hey, 2012 is only about 9 days away.
